Management Commentary
Management commentary during the Q3 2025 earnings call highlighted the bank's continued focus on core operational strength, with diluted earnings per share reaching $0.64. Executives attributed this performance to disciplined expense management and steady net interest income, despite a challenging rate environment. The shift in deposit mix toward higher-cost funding was noted as a headwind, but the team expressed confidence in the bank's ability to navigate margin compression through prudent pricing strategies and a well-diversified loan portfolio.
Operational highlights included sustained credit quality, with nonperforming assets remaining at minimal levels. Management emphasized investments in digital banking capabilities and customer service initiatives, which have contributed to modest loan growth in commercial and agricultural segments. The bank's capital position was described as robust, exceeding regulatory minimums and providing flexibility for strategic opportunities. While economic uncertainty persists in the region, executives reiterated a cautious but optimistic outlook, focusing on relationship-based banking and cost control to support profitability in the near term.

Forward Guidance
Ohio Bancorp (OVBC) management, during the Q3 2025 earnings call, provided a measured outlook for the remainder of the fiscal year. The company anticipates that net interest income may face continued pressure from the elevated interest rate environment, though deposit repricing could moderate in the coming quarters. Executives noted that loan demand remains stable in its core markets, with commercial and industrial lending expected to contribute incremental growth. However, they cautioned that economic uncertainty could temper borrowing activity.
On expense management, OVBC expects to maintain disciplined cost control, with potential efficiencies from recent technology investments. The bank’s credit quality metrics remain healthy, but management acknowledged that provisioning levels may increase modestly given the broader economic backdrop. No specific earnings-per-share guidance was provided for future periods, but the company reiterated its focus on generating consistent profitability. Capital levels are anticipated to remain robust, supporting organic expansion and strategic initiatives.
Overall, OVBC appears to be navigating a challenging landscape with a cautious stance, prioritizing balance sheet strength and prudent risk management. Investors should watch for further commentary on margin trends and loan growth when the next quarterly results are released.

Market Reaction
Shares of Ohio Valley Banc Corporation (OVBC) saw modest activity following the release of its third-quarter 2025 earnings, with the stock trading in a relatively narrow range in the days after the announcement. The reported earnings per share of $0.64 came in slightly above some analyst estimates, which appeared to provide a floor for the stock after a period of consolidation. Trading volume was somewhat elevated compared to recent averages, suggesting renewed investor attention on the regional bank.
Analysts have noted that while the earnings beat may be a positive sign, the lack of specific revenue disclosure left some questions about the underlying driver of the EPS outperformance—whether from core operations or one-time items. Some market observers have pointed to the bank's stable loan portfolio and local market positioning as potential supports, but cautioned that broader interest rate pressures could weigh on future performance. The stock's price has since held near its pre-earnings level, reflecting a cautious but not negative market sentiment. Overall, the market reaction suggests investors are taking a wait-and-see approach, monitoring OVBC's ability to sustain this earnings momentum in coming quarters.
